C
InEnglandrecentlythreeforeigngentlemencametoabusstopandwaited.About
fiveminuteslater,thebustheywantedcamealong.Theywerejustgoingtogeton
whensuddenlytherewasaloudnoisebehindthem.Peoplerushedontothebusandtried
topushthemoutoftheway.Someoneshoutedatthem.Thebusconductorcamerushing
downthestairstoseewhatallthetroublewasabout.Thethreeforeignersseemed
allatseaandlookedembarrassed.NoonehadtoldthemabouttheBritishcustomof
liningupforabusthatthefirstpersonwhoarrivesatthebusstopisthefirst
persontogetonthebus.
Learningthelanguageofacountryisntenough.Ifyouwanttohaveapleasant
visit,findoutasmuchaspossibleaboutthemannersandcustomsofyourhost
country.Youwillprobablybesurprisedjusthowdifferenttheycanbefromyourown.A
visitortoIndiawoulddowelltorememberthatpeoplethereconsideritimpolite
tousethelefthandforpassingfoodattable.Thelefthandissupposedtobeused
forwashingyourself.AlsoinIndia,youmightseeamanshakinghisheadatanother
toshowthathedoesn,tagree.ButinmanypartsofIndiaashakeoftheheadmeans
agreement.NoddingyourheadwhenyouaregivenadrinkinBulgariawillmostprobably
leaveyouthirsty.

D
Asimplegesturecanbeformedintoachild,smemorysoquicklythatitwi11
causethechildtogiveafalseanswertoaquestionaccompaniedbythatgesture.A
newfindingsuggeststhatparents,socialworkers,psychologistsandlawyersshould
becarefulwiththeirhandsaswellastheirwords.
Gesturescanbeasinformativeasspeech,buthandgesturesaresocommonthat
werarelynoticewhenwe'reusingthem.
Whiletherecollection(回憶)ofbothadultsandchildreniseasytoreactto
suggestion,thememoriesofchildrenareknowntobeparticularlyinfluenced,said
leadresearcherSaraBroadersofNorthwesternUniversity.Kidsareusedtolooking
toadultstotelleventsforthemandcanbemisledevenifnotintentionally.
Previousresearch,forexample,hasshownthatdetailedquestionsoftencause
falseanswers;whenasked,say,"Didyoudrinkjuiceatthepicnic?”thechild
islikelytosay"yes"evenifnojuicehadbeenavailable.It'snotthatthechild
islyingonpurpose.Rather,thedetailisquicklyformedintohisorhermemory.
Toavoidthisproblem,socialworkershavelongbeenadvisedtoaskchildren
onlyopen-endedquestions,suchasuWhatdidyouhaveatthepicnic?”Butan
open-endedquestionpairedwithagesture,brieflymeaningajuicebox,istreated
likeadetailedquestion.Thatis,childrenbecomelikelytoanswerfalsely.
Anditisn,tjustafewkids:77%ofchildrengaveatleastonepieceoffalse
informationwhenadetailwassuggestedbyanordinarygesture.Gesturesmayalso
becomemorepopularwhentalkingwithnon-fluentlanguageusers,suchaslittlekids,
Broaderssaid,ashandmovementscanimpartmeaningofunfamiliarwordsand
phrases."Itcertainlyseemsreasonablethatadultswouldgesturemorewith
children.”
Ingeneral,Broadersadvisesparentsandotheradultsto“trytobeawareof
yourhandswhenquestioningachildaboutanevent.Otherwise,youmightbegetting
answersthatdon'treflectwhatactuallyhappened.”
